The GIS Analyst is responsible for developing, maintaining, and analyzing geographic information system (GIS) data to support planning, operations, and decision-making across the Organization. This role ensures the accuracy, consistency, and accessibility of spatial data, producing maps, visualizations, and analyses that effectively communicate complex geographic information.

Key responsibilities include creating, updating, and managing GIS databases; performing data quality assurance; and integrating data from multiple sources to produce accurate spatial analyses and visual outputs. The GIS Analyst prepares detailed maps, reports, and other graphical representations for use by internal departments and the public, supporting both strategic initiatives and day-to-day operations.

The role also conducts field verification and geospatial data collection to resolve data discrepancies and ensure alignment with real-world conditions. The GIS Analyst works closely with technical staff and stakeholders to ensure GIS data supports project planning, asset management, and policy evaluation.

This position requires strong analytical skills, technical proficiency with GIS software, and the ability to translate spatial data into actionable insights. The GIS Analyst plays a key role in advancing data-driven decision-making and operational efficiency across the Organization. 

Requirements

Bachelor's Degree in Geography, Urban Planning or related field.

Experience in data analysis, ESRI ArcGIS, and Microsoft.
